The famed Promenade des Anglais beachside walkway of the French Mediterranean city of Nice is closed as part of weekend lockdown measures imposed to tackle the COVID-19 pandemic. Nice, South of France on February 27, 2021. Photo by Lucie Choquet/ABACAPRESS.COM

Local residents in Dunkirk, northern France, on February 27, 2021, during the first weekend lockdown put in place by authorities to attempt to halt the spread of the coronavirus (Covid-19) pandemic. As on the French Riviera around Nice, local residents in Dunkirk and the surrounding area are only allowed to leave their homes for specific authorised reasons.
